Circulating tumor DNA (ctDNA) has potential as a basis for understanding the molecular features of a tumor non-invasively and for use as a diagnostic, prognostic, and disease-monitoring marker. The aim of this study was to evaluate the clinical roles of ctDNA in patients with endometrial cancer.
